Ingredients for Blueberry Cream Cheese Quick Bread

- 1 cup (5 oz/142 g) fresh blueberries
- 1 tablespoon plus 1 cup (5 oz/142 g) all-purpose flour (divided)
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½ cup (4 oz/115 g) butter, at room temperature (softened)
- ½ cup (4 oz/115 g) cream cheese, at room temperature (softened)
- ¾ cup (6 oz/170 g) granulated sugar
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est (freshly grated)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 large eggs, at room temperature
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C). Butter a 9×5-inch (12½x 25½-cm) loaf pan and line it with parchment paper. Set aside.
- In a small bowl, toss the blueberries with 1 tablespoon of flour to coat them evenly. Set aside.
- In another bowl, whisk together the remaining 1 cup of fl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.
- In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with a paddle attachment (or using a handheld electric mixer), beat the butter, cream cheese, sugar, and lemon zest on medium-high speed until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es.
- Add the vanilla extract, then be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
- Fold in the dry ingredients until just combined. Gently mix in the floured blueberries.
- Scrape the batter into the prepared loaf pan and spread it evenly.
- Bake for about 65 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Let c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er the bread to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days.

Keep It Fresh: Storage and Reheating Tips
Store your bread in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er storage,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and freeze for up to 2 months. To reheat, slice the bread and warm it in a toaster oven or microwave for 10-15 seconds. This will bring back its soft, moist texture and enhance the flavors.
Mix It Up: Recipe Variations
Feel free to get creative with this recipe! Swap blueberries for raspberries or blackberries for a different fruity twist. Add a handful of chopped nuts like walnuts or pecans for extra crunch. If you love citrus, increase the lemon zest to 2 teaspoons or add a splash of lemon juice to the batter. For a decadent touch, drizzle a simple glaze made of powdered sugar and milk over the cooled loaf.
Quick Tips for Success
To ensure your bread turns out perfectly, make sure all your ingredients are at room temperature before mixing. This helps create a smooth, even batter. Don’t overmix the batter once you add the dry ingredients—just fold until combined to keep the bread tender. Finally, toss the blueberries in flour to prevent them from sinking to the bottom during baking.
